Scope
Encompassing the broad spectrum of epigenetics research from basic research to innovations in therapeutic treatments, Clinical Epigenetics is a top tier, open access journal devoted to the study of epigenetic principles and mechanisms as applied to human development, disease, diagnosis and treatment. The journal particularly welcomes submissions involving clinical trials, translational research, new and innovative methodologies and model organisms providing mechanistic insights. The journal is divided into the following sections: Aging and development epigenetics, Allergy, immunology, and pathogen epigenetics, Cancer epigenetics and diagnostics, Cardiovascular epigenetics, Endocrinology and metabolic epigenetics, Environmental epigenetics, Epigenetic biomarkers, Epigenetic technologies, Epigenetic Drugs, Trials and Therapy, Innovative therapies, Lifestyle epigenetics, Neurology and psychiatry epigenetics, Regenerative medicine, Reproductive and transgenerational epigenetics.
